Poet Rupi Kaur
Resilience can be about coming to terms with the obstacles in front of you. As we minimize touching and practice social isolation, it's starting to feel like at least part of this experience will have to become part of our forever experience. Rupi Kaur spoke about the power of resilience in her own life. Special thanks to Indspire, Enbridge and Concordia University for their support for The Walrus Talks. Hosted on Acast.
